So I was playing skullgirls with my fightstick it switched me back to keyboard controls when I switched windows and came back so I unplugged it and plugged it back in and it worked fine. Then I switched windows and came back and it did the same thing but this time when I unplugged it an plugged it back in it didn't fix it. Now when I plug it in it says it's an unknown device. I have had issues with it about a week ago where it was trying to install the windows xbox controller v2.06 instead of the windows xbox controller 6.0 drivers which I fixed by manually switching it. But when that happened it was still showing up under controllers in device manager however now it's showing up as an unknown device under the Universal Serial Buses tab in device manager which means I can't select the xbox controller driver for it again. Not sure what's up so hopefully someone does

It should be noted that while it stops working and turns into an unknown device skullgirls still recognizes that it's plugged in until you unplug it and that my 360 controller will still work even after the fightstick using the same driver does not.

i would go into the device manager and uninstall the usb root hub(s); keeping in mind if you do that and you use a wireless keyboard and a wireless mouse; it will deactivate them until you reboot and windows finds and installs the drivers for them. So if you can; do that using a wired keyboard and a wired mouse.
